> I am looking for supported RAID 5 controller for FreeBSD and
> I am very puzzled after reading all the specs and descrioptions.
>
> I haven't found any SATA RAID 5 controller in the FreeBSD
> supported Hardware list, but some manufacturer claim they
> support FreeBSD.
>
> SO far i have found
> 1) Promise FastTrak SX4 (around 200$)
> 2) HighPoint RocketRaid 1640 (aorund 150$ hard to find)
> 3) EscaladeR 8506 4-port one (around 500$)
>
> HightPoint and Escalade AFAIK are well supported by FreeBSD.
> FreeBSD 4.8 support is promised in Promise :) FastTrak.
>
I have the Adaptec 2410SA. It supports 4 drives, has its own CPU and
64mb cache, and runs with the aac controller under 5.2. It seems to
run pretty well. (Note: this is a totally different beast than the
2400A ATA controller)
